预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

WSN中基于网格的覆盖控制与群优化研究 摘要:无线传感器网络(WSN)是一种用于收集和传输环境数据的技术。WSN的覆盖控制和能耗管理是实现WSN目标的重要挑战。本研究旨在探索基于网格的覆盖控制和群优化算法,以提高能耗和覆盖率效率。 1.简介 WSN技术是一种无线网络技术,其节点可以通过无线通信方式进行通信,并具有收集和传输传感数据的能力。但是,WSN具有节点数量众多、能源有限、通信轮廓特殊等诸多挑战。因此,WSN的覆盖控制和能耗管理是实现WSN目标的重要挑战。本研究旨在探索基于网格的覆盖控制和群优化算法,以提高能耗和覆盖率效率。 2.相关工作 目前,已经有多种算法用于WSN中的覆盖控制和能耗管理,如基于节点密度的覆盖控制、基于集群的能耗管理等。然而,这些算法在解决前一方面的问题时通常会忽略后一方面的问题,因此需要综合考虑这两个方面的问题。 3.基于网格的覆盖控制 基于网格的覆盖控制是一种优化算法,它通过将感知区域划分为网格来解决WSN中的覆盖问题。该算法通过定义网格度量标准并设计一个自适应机制来优化网络的覆盖率和能耗管理。该算法的主要思想是在WSN区域中放置一定数量的传感器节点,并通过调整节点位置和覆盖范围,以实现最小化能耗并保持良好的覆盖率。 4.群优化算法 群优化算法是仿生优化算法的一种,旨在解决优化问题和计算困难问题。群优化算法模拟了自然界中动物或昆虫的行为,例如鸟群和蚁群。相关的算法包括粒子群优化、人工蜂群等。这些算法通过模拟动物或昆虫在搜索过程中的行为和交互来求解最优解。 5.基于网格的群优化算法 本研究中,基于网格的群优化算法被提出。该算法将网格分为多个单元,并且将每个单元看作一个个体。每个个体都代表与单元中全部或部分信息相同的一组传感器节点,任务是为每个单元选择最佳传感器节点组合,并考虑覆盖和能耗的因素。 6.实验结果和分析 本研究使用NS-2仿真平台进行实验。结果表明,基于网格的覆盖控制可以有效地维持网络的覆盖率,并减少能耗。同时,基于网格的群优化算法也可以提高覆盖率和降低能耗,并且对于节点密度较高的网络,其效果尤为显著。 7.总结和展望 本研究的主要贡献在于,提出基于网格的覆盖控制和群优化算法,通过将两种算法的优势相结合,提高了WSN中的能耗效率和覆盖率,并在仿真实验中得到了验证。未来的研究可以进一步完善该算法,以适应实际网络环境的需要。